Which Is Cheaper Concrete Patio Or Deck at Benjamin Denny blog

Which Is Cheaper Concrete Patio Or Deck. Patios generally cost less to build than decks since they are made of more affordable materials like concrete or stone. Patios, a wood deck costs $25 to $50 per square foot on average, while a paver patio costs $10 to $17 per square foot, and a poured concrete patio. Concrete patios costs range from $6 to $17 per square foot for basic installation. Which one is right for you? When comparing concrete vs decking cost, a concrete patio is nearly always cheaper, though this depends on whether you’re doing any of the job yourself and the type of timber or concrete you choose.
